Is heating included in rent NYC
Most leases include this information; if yours does not, you should inquire to make sure. Heat and hot water are the two utilities that are usually included in the rent for New Yorkers.

How much are monthly NYC utilities
According to data from Numbeo.com, the average basic utilities package for a 915 square foot home in New York City will cost $170.01 in March 2022. This price includes heating, electricity, water, and garbage and is comparable to the US average for a months worth of basic utilities ($170.09).
How long does it take for Con Edison to start service
Your new gas service will begin on the first day of the month, as long as you enrolled by the 15th of the previous month. Your new electric service will begin on your next meter reading date, as long as you enrolled by the 15th of the previous month. Otherwise, your service will start on the meter reading date after that.
Who provides gas service in NYC
To start or transfer your natural gas service with National Grid, please go here. Gas service provides many New Yorkers with heat and energy for cooking. National Grid provides gas service to Brooklyn, Staten Island, and most of Queens, including the Rockaways.
Is National Grid and Con Edison the same
Con Edison is the natural gas service provider for buildings in Manhattan, the Bronx, and portions of Queens; National Grid is the natural gas service provider for buildings in Brooklyn, Staten Island, and portions of Queens.
